New Delhi, Feb. 20 -- On her first day in office as chief minister of Delhi on Thursday, Rekha Gupta hit back at former CM and Aam Admi Party (AAP) leader Atishi over her comment asking the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P)-led government to fulfil the promises. Gupta said the former CM doesn't need to tell the ruling dispensation everything.

After congratulating Shalimar Bagh MLA Rekha Gupta, who became Delhi's fourth woman chief minister, Atishi hoped that the BJP would fulfil its promises, including Rs.2,500 per month for every woman.

However, reacting to the AAP leader's remark, Gupta said that they would fulfil all their commitments to the people.
